
Baskerville & Birmingham
About Baskerville & Birmingham
250 years ago, John Baskerville, the Birmingham printer, publisher, craftsperson, inventor, and freethinker passed away. His work, particularly his typeface, put Birmingham on the map, but since then he has often been forgotten or misremembered! So, John and his wife Sarah are back on this anniversary to set the story straight on their life and legacy, all while inducting you into their world of printing and craft.
Learn about his progressive ideas for improving life for Birmingham citizens, try out one of his inventions and share your ideas for the city’s Big Green Future City Planner.
